Locodarwin Posted November 3, 2006 Share Posted November 3, 2006 If you're looking for information regarding the COM collections, properties, and methods used in MS Word, Excel, and Access, the following items will be your best friends:1. Macro recorder. Start recording, do what you want your script to do, stop recording, then examine the macro code that results in the VBA editor (ALT+F11).2. The VBA object browser, available by hitting F2 once inside the VBA editor. You can get context-sensitive help on any supported object and its methods. Has a great search function.3. MSDN's Office automation documentation, online: MSDN Office4. Professional VBA books and tutorials.I have used a combination of all of these things.
